Packing for a move is a daunting task! It’s even more challenging when you’re forced to move without a lot of notice. If you find yourself needing to relocate on a whim, here are five tips to pack for a last minute move.
1. Gather your supplies.
The first step is gathering supplies, such as tape, bubble wrap, boxes, and labels. At this point, you can’t waste time gathering boxes here and there. Head to your nearest supply store and purchase everything you need. That way, you can start packing immediately.
2. Pack essentials first.
Pack essentials, such as medications you take daily, in the very beginning. Label your boxes clearly so you don’t lose track of your most critical items.
3. Declutter while you pack.
In order to lighten your load as much as possible, throw away or donate items you no longer need while packing. Now is the perfect time to declutter so you don’t bring unnecessary items into your new home. The last thing you want is to haul a bunch of belongings to your new space that you no longer use or want.
4. Sort later.
Unfortunately, since you’re moving last minute, you don’t have time to leisurely organize your things. Instead of meticulously packing in an organized fashion, focus on wrapping your items carefully and protecting them from damage during the move.
